Nicholas J. Hand, PhD, is a Research Associate Professor in the Department of Genetics at the University of Pennsylvania. His research focuses on molecular biology, liver diseases, and microRNA regulation, with significant contributions to understanding cardiometabolic diseases and cholestatic liver conditions. He is affiliated with the Rader lab and leads independent investigations into haploinsufficiency disorders.
Education:
- BA in Genetics, Trinity College, Dublin, 1992
- PhD in Molecular Biology, Princeton University, 2002
- Postdoctoral Fellow, University of Pennsylvania, 2002–2005
- Postdoctoral Fellow, Children’s Hospital of Philadelphia, 2005–2007
- Research Associate II, Children’s Hospital of Philadelphia, 2007–2011
Research Interests:
Dr. Hand is a broadly trained molecular biologist with a long-standing interest in liver diseases and microRNA-mediated gene regulation. His work is informed by human genetics and involves the use of iPSC-derived hepatocytes, CRISPR/Cas9, and mouse models to study gene function and disease mechanisms. His research spans:
- Cardiometabolic disease
- Cholestatic liver disease
- Nonalcoholic fatty liver disease (NAFLD)
- Lipid and lipoprotein metabolism
- MicroRNA as biomarkers and therapeutic targets
Publication Trends:
Dr. Hand’s recent publications reflect a strong focus on translational genomics and metabolic disease. His work integrates genome-wide association studies (GWAS) with functional genomics to uncover causal genes and mechanisms underlying liver and metabolic disorders. Notable themes include the role of specific genes (e.g., PPP1R3B, TM6SF2, PLIN2) in hepatic lipid metabolism, the use of iPSC-derived models, and the identification of circulating microRNAs as biomarkers for liver disease.
Labs and Collaborations:
Dr. Hand is a key member of the Rader lab at the University of Pennsylvania, where he directs functional follow-up of genetic discoveries. He also leads an independent research group focused on cholestatic liver disease and haploinsufficiency disorders.
